Fortive Corporation's first quarter as New Fortive Corporation, now three quarters into its post-spin existence following the July 2025 separation, delivered results that meaningfully exceeded expectations across every major financial metric. Core revenue grew just over 5% (aided by roughly 150 basis points from additional year-over-year selling days), reported revenue reached nearly $1.1 billion, adjusted EBITDA expanded 13% to $314 million with margin improvement of approximately 140 basis points to just over 29%, and adjusted EPS of $0.70 represented growth of over 25% year over year, the third consecutive quarter of double-digit EPS growth. The EPS result came in well ahead of the $0.64 consensus estimate, driven by a combination of operating leverage, structural cost savings, favorable foreign exchange, and the continued accretive impact of aggressive share repurchases.
